Bianca Lee is a Toronto-based sound therapist, artist, educator and DJ.
Bianca Lee Mondino (artist name: Bianca Lee) is a certified sound therapy practitioner, multidisciplinary artist, educator, and DJ. She specializes in using sound as a functional tool to ease anxiety, reduce overstimulation, and support travel-related stress.
With a deep belief in the power of sound to soothe the nervous system and reconnect us to ourselves, Bianca creates immersive soundscapes, workshops, and installations that blend therapeutic intention with artistic expression. She also leads independent research and social sound experiments exploring how music influences emotional states, connection, and the listening experience — most recently studying travel anxiety, posture-based listening and music’s role in fostering connection.
With Italian roots, Bianca was exposed to classical music at an early age. Witnessing a live symphony performance sparked a lifelong love for evocative and transformative sound experiences — a thread that continues through her current work. Inspired by artists like Jon Hopkins, Brian Eno, Fred Again.., The Wong Janice, and Max Cooper, she creates ambient, meditative music that guides listeners on an emotional journey.
Bianca’s sound wellness practice is grounded in science-backed techniques and trauma-informed facilitation. Whether calming a plane full of anxious travellers, creating a restorative pause in a busy workplace, or curating a public installation, her mission is to make the benefits of sound therapy both accessible and artistically inspiring.
Her own journey with debilitating anxiety profoundly informs her work — and inspired her bold transition from an award-winning career in corporate banking to a life dedicated to music and wellness.
With over nine years of experience in the music and wellness industries, Bianca has collaborated with prestigious clients such as Disney, Marvel Studios, YouTube, Holt Renfrew, Bumble, Elevate Tech Fest, the Toronto International Film Festival, and Pitbull’s Globalization. Her unique blend of skills has also led to speaking engagements with influential organizations like TEDxYouth, Fuckup Nights Hamilton, and Women of Influence.
In 2024, Bianca was featured on Cityline TV and introduced the first-ever immersive sound bath installation at The Royal Ontario Museum.
Bianca is also a guest lecturer at the University of Toronto’s School of Continuing Studies, where she shares her knowledge on the therapeutic uses of sound.
